Description Marc Schoenefeld 2008-07-09 06:53:57 EDT
Sunalert, 238905, Third Issue 

A vulnerability in Java Web Start may allow an untrusted Java Web Start
application downloaded from a website to create or delete arbitrary files with
the permissions of the user running the untrusted Java Web Start application.
